AI Rollout Failure Starts With the First Meeting

When employees feel threatened, they do not become collaborators. They become silent resistors. And silent resistance is the most expensive operational problem a company can have, because it never shows up on any report.


Most leaders who experience AI rollout failure spend months looking in the wrong direction. They examine the technology. They audit the vendor. They question the timeline. What they rarely examine is the moment the project was lost, which in my experience across industries happened before a single tool was deployed. It happened in the room where the rollout was first introduced.






The Meeting That Ends the Project


There is a pattern I have seen across different industries, and it plays out the same way every time.


Leadership schedules a meeting to introduce an AI initiative. The presentation covers capabilities, timelines, and efficiency gains. Somewhere in the first ten minutes, a phrase surfaces: "figure out where you still add value," or "roles will evolve as AI handles more of the work," or simply the framing that employees should expect significant changes to how their jobs function.


In that moment, every person in the room makes the same decision simultaneously. They stop evaluating the technology. They start evaluating their exposure.

They smile and nod. They ask polite questions. And then they go back to their desks and quietly begin protecting themselves.


This is not disengagement. This is rational self-preservation. When an employee believes their position is provisional, every piece of operational knowledge they hold becomes a survival asset. The workarounds they have built, the institutional knowledge that lives only in their head: all of it becomes leverage to remain necessary.


The AI rollout does not fail because the technology is wrong. It fails because the team that was supposed to implement it is now, very quietly, making sure it cannot fully replace them.

What Silent Resistance Actually Costs


Silent resistance is dangerous precisely because it produces no visible signal. The team shows up to every meeting. They complete assigned tasks. They report progress. The project appears to be moving.


What is actually happening is that the implementation proceeds on the surface while the knowledge layer underneath stays locked. In my experience across different industries, silent resistance tends to show up in the same observable patterns:


  • Process maps submitted to the implementation team describe the official workflow, not the one the team actually runs

  • Exception handling that has always been managed informally stays undocumented, because documenting it removes the person who manages it from the equation

  • Workarounds that compensate for upstream process failures go unmentioned in mapping sessions

  • Informal coordination between departments, the kind that keeps things from falling through the cracks, never gets captured because it has no official owner

  • Knowledge about what the process breaks under pressure, and how the team compensates, stays in people's heads rather than entering the system


Each one of these gaps looks small in isolation. Together, they mean the AI tool is trained on an idealized version of the operation rather than the real one.


Months later, leadership is looking at an AI tool that is technically deployed but producing underwhelming results. The vendor gets blamed. The timeline gets extended. The budget takes another hit. The actual cause, a trust problem created in the first meeting, never gets identified.


The cost is real and it compounds. Implementation budgets get consumed without delivering the efficiency gains that justified the investment. Margin does not improve. The tool sits in partial use while the operational problems it was supposed to solve continue running as they always have.

Why Employees Protect What They Know


The instinct to protect institutional knowledge is not a character flaw. It is a structural response to a perceived threat.


When the conversation around AI is framed as productivity optimization, employees hear that the goal is to produce the same output with fewer people. They are often correct. The mistake is expecting those same employees to enthusiastically collaborate on a project that, from their vantage point, may result in their own elimination.


What I observe consistently across industries is that the employees who are most threatened are often the most operationally critical. They hold the knowledge that is hardest to transfer: the process exceptions, the client preferences, the internal dependencies that live nowhere but in their heads. When they disengage, the rollout loses the most important inputs it needs to succeed. The AI tool gets trained on incomplete information. The process maps are sanitized. The institutional knowledge that would have made the automation meaningful never enters the system.


The result is a technology that performs correctly on the inputs it received, which were not the real inputs. It solves the version of the problem that exists on paper, while the actual operational problem continues running as it always has.

What the Data Shows Leaders Get Wrong


The McKinsey State of AI 2025 survey, which drew responses from nearly 2,000 business leaders across 105 countries, found that 32 percent of respondents expect an enterprise-wide workforce reduction of 3 percent or more due to AI in the coming year. Looking at individual business functions, a median of 30 percent of respondents expect AI-related decreases in workforce size ahead, compared with 17 percent who actually observed reductions in the prior year.


That gap is the number employees are watching. They may not have seen the McKinsey report. But they are reading the signals their leadership is sending about why AI is being introduced, and they are drawing conclusions that are largely correct.



What that expectation gap represents operationally is a workforce that is psychologically oriented toward self-protection at the exact moment a business is asking for full collaboration. That is not a coincidence. That is the direct result of how most AI conversations get framed from the top.


The framing problem is structural. Leaders who built the business case for AI adoption understand the productivity and efficiency rationale. They present it honestly. What they do not account for is how that honest presentation lands when the person hearing it is calculating whether they still have a role in twelve months.


An employee who hears "AI will handle the routine work, and you will focus on higher-value tasks" may receive that message very differently depending on whether their work has ever been described as anything other than routine. The framing that feels optimistic to a leader feels like a timeline to a team member.


AI Rollout Failure Is an Operational Problem, Not a Technology Problem


The fix requires addressing the problem where it actually lives: in the operational conditions that made the rollout vulnerable before it started.


That means the process infrastructure needs to be sound before the automation layer is added. It means the workflows being mapped for AI are actually the workflows the team runs, not idealized versions of them. It means the exception handling, the informal coordination, the institutional knowledge that exists only in people's heads has been surfaced and accounted for before the tool is trained on any of it.


It also means the trust conversation has to happen before the technology conversation. Employees who understand that their operational knowledge is the most valuable input in the implementation, and who are treated as contributors rather than threats to the efficiency calculation, behave differently. They surface the real process. They flag the problems. They identify the gaps that would have caused the automation to fail six months into deployment.


That is the work. Not the technology layer, but the operational structure underneath it. AI tools do not fix broken processes. They amplify them. Frequently Asked Questions


Why do AI rollouts fail even when the technology is good?


Most AI rollout failure has nothing to do with the quality of the technology. The failure traces back to the operational conditions underneath the implementation. When processes are not structured correctly before automation is applied, when institutional knowledge has not been surfaced and mapped, or when the team responsible for implementation has disengaged due to trust concerns, the technology performs on incomplete inputs. The result is a tool that works technically but does not produce the business outcomes it was purchased to deliver.


How does employee resistance show up in an AI implementation?


Silent resistance rarely looks like resistance. It looks like compliance. Employees attend meetings, complete assigned tasks, and report progress. What they do not do is volunteer the operational knowledge that makes the implementation succeed. In practice, this shows up in patterns that are consistent across industries: process maps submitted to the implementation team describe the official workflow rather than the one the team actually runs; exception handling managed informally stays undocumented; workarounds that compensate for upstream failures go unmentioned in mapping sessions; informal coordination between departments never gets captured because it has no official owner; and knowledge about what breaks the process under pressure stays in people's heads rather than entering the system. Each gap looks small in isolation. Together, they mean the tool gets trained on a sanitized version of the operation rather than the real one.


What should a leader do differently before launching an AI initiative?


The trust conversation has to happen before the technology conversation. McKinsey's 2025 State of AI survey found that a median of 30 percent of business leaders expect AI-related workforce reductions in the year ahead, up from 17 percent who observed them in the prior year. Employees are reading those signals before anyone opens a presentation. A leader who frames the rollout around efficiency gains without directly addressing what that means for the people in the room is not being dishonest, but they are handing every employee a reason to withhold cooperation. Beyond the trust dimension, the operational infrastructure needs to be sound before automation is applied. Processes that are exception-heavy, informally managed, or dependent on individual knowledge should be surfaced and stabilized before they are handed to an AI system to replicate. The sequence matters: people first, process second, technology third.


Is this problem specific to AI or does it show up with other technology implementations?


This pattern is not unique to AI. It appears across any technology implementation where the human knowledge layer is treated as a secondary concern. ERP deployments, workflow automation, CRM implementations, and operational restructurings all follow the same failure pattern when the process foundation is not right and the people holding institutional knowledge are not treated as essential contributors. AI makes the problem more visible because the stakes are higher and the speed of deployment is faster, but the structural issue is the same.


How do you know when an organization is actually ready for an AI rollout?


Readiness is an operational question, not a calendar question. An organization is ready when its processes are stable enough to be mapped accurately, when the exception handling those processes require is understood and accounted for, and when the people closest to the work have been part of the conversation rather than presented with a conclusion. Operationally ready also means the business can describe what success looks like at the process level, not just at the output level, so there is a defined standard against which the implementation can be measured. In practice, most organizations that believe they are ready have gaps in one or more of these areas that only become visible when someone outside the operation examines it without the blind spots that proximity creates.
